I love that RDA's love of The Simpsons is reflected in the show. There's plenty of small references, but it culminates in "Citizen Joe", where the actor who plays Homer stars.

And then RDA goes on The Simpsons in a pretty funny episode.

IIRC, part of the joke is that the Simpsons aired in the same timeslot as MacGuyver, which is why he makes the reference about always having to record it. There's also the long-running joke in the Simpsons about Patty and Selma being obsessed with MacGuyver too (which is the premise of the Simpsons episode you referenced.)
